THE SPIRIT OF MICHAEL JACKSON to Play Ridgefield Playhouse, 3/4

By:
Pepsi Rock Series Powered by Xfinity and Ridgefield Academy Family Series want you to come and rock out to Michael Jackson's greatest hits when Laser Spectacular's The Spirit of Michael Jackson returns to The Ridgefield Playhouse on Friday, March 4 at 7:30 pm. The show pays tribute to the pop legends' life and legacy with a stunning stage presentation featuring one of the top Michael Jackson impersonators straight from the Vegas stage! The show's dance troupe performs all of Michael Jackson's choreography to perfection! The production includes lasers, large screen video projection, concert lighting and 50,000 watts of awesome sound. Spanning his forty year career, the show will take the audience on a visual journey that captures the essence of Michael Jacksons' worldwide concert appearances. Media sponsor for this one-night-only event is WEBE 108fm.

Many of Michael Jackson's hits lend themselves to an artistic laser and light performance. Through the use of animated laser graphics, laser beams and aerials, the lights and lasers re-create images of Michael with 3-D holographic effects. The lighting show is a concert-style configuration. Along with the laser beams and graphics, it's certain to wow the audience with the same power and excitement of a live concert. In the course of the show, these special moments are coupled with some of his famous short films such as "Thriller" and "Black or White", and other big hit memories from MTV. Special interview segments feature people from all walks of life remembering Michael, and so honoring him as one of the most outstanding performers of our time.
